site stats

Select compatibility_level from sys.databases

WebMar 3, 2024 · To view or change the compatibility level of a database using SQL Server Management Studio (SSMS) Connect to the appropriate server or instance hosting your … WebAug 26, 2010 · If it is intended as a parameter to a table-valued function, ensure that your database compatibility mode is set to 90. – user295190 Aug 26, 2010 at 20:20 Like I said 2005 and up only, for 2000 run profiler. Next time indicate which version of sql server you are running – SQLMenace Aug 26, 2010 at 20:21 2 Not according to the error.

SQL Server Rebuilds and Reorganize Script for Index Fragmentation

WebJan 27, 2016 · The sys.objects view is a handy tool to have because it provides quick and easy access to all user-defined objects in your database, including tables, views, triggers, functions, and constraints. However, SQL Server also provides catalog views that are distinct to a specific object type. For example, the following SELECT statement retrieves data … WebMay 20, 2024 · 4. With this query, you can get a list of all databases and the database compatibility level. Compatibility level is associated with each database. It allows the behaviour of the database to be compatible with the specific version of the SQL Server it is running on. SELECT name, compatibility_level FROM sys.databases; 5. This will list all ... christopher mcclure md https://bricoliamoci.com

tsql - How to check SQL Server Database compatibility after sp

WebDec 12, 2024 · To fix this, either increase the compatibility level of your database to 130 or higher, or change to a database that already has the appropriate compatibility level. Check the Compatibility Level of the Database You can query sys.databases to check the compatibility level of the database. WebMay 29, 2024 · is_auto_update_stats_on, is_auto_update_stats_async_on, delayed_durability_desc from sys.databases; GO select * from … Web12 rows · May 8, 2024 · SELECT compatibility_level FROM sys.databases WHERE name = 'WideWorldImporters'; Result: ... SELECT GETDATE(); Result: 2024-05-06 23:30:37.003. In this case we use T-SQL’… SQL Server is a relational database management system (RDBMS) developed by … get tomorrow date

How to Check a Database’s Compatibility Level in SQL …

Category:How can I query the SQL Server Compatibility Level into a variable ...

Tags:Select compatibility_level from sys.databases

Select compatibility_level from sys.databases

How to check Database Compatibility Level SQL Server?

WebNov 4, 2024 · In SQL Server, you can use the ALTER DATABASE statement to change the compatibility level of a database. This can be useful if you have a database that was created in an earlier version of SQL Server, but you now need to use features that are only available with a later compatibility level. For example, the OPENJSON () function is available ... WebYou could query the system table sys.databases: -- for SQL 2005+ declare @level tinyint; select @level = [compatibility_level] from sys.databases where name = 'AdventureWorks' Select @level GO -- for SQL 2000+ declare @level tinyint; select @level = [cmptlevel] from sysdatabases where name = 'AdventureWorks' Select @level GO Share

Select compatibility_level from sys.databases

Did you know?

WebJan 9, 2024 · DECLARE @sys_compatibility_level tinyint, @db_compatibility_level tinyint; SELECT @sys_compatibility_level = compatibility_level FROM sys.databases WHERE name = 'master'; SELECT @db_compatibility_level = compatibility_level FROM sys.databases WHERE name = DB_NAME (); DECLARE @db_name nvarchar (128) = DB_NAME (); IF … WebTo use the legacy cardinality estimator without the specific setting, change the compatibility level to 110, which is the level used in SQL Server 2012. For each database: Right click on the database and click Properties Click Options Change Compatibility level to …

WebDec 4, 2024 · SYS_CHANGE_OPERATION here is I (Insert) as expected. Now if I update the row. UPDATE T SET Col1 = 'UPDATE' FROM dbo.TestCT T WHERE Col1 = 'INSERT1'; GO SYS_CHANGE_OPERATION here is still I (Insert) and not U (Update). As you can see SYS_CHANGE_VERSION has incremented by 1 as expected. What am I doing wrong here? WebNov 28, 2024 · SELECT ServerProperty('ProductVersion'); SELECT d.name, d.compatibility_level FROM sys.databases AS d WHERE d.name = ''; To update the compatibility version to the latest version to match our SQL Server vNext database engine, we’d run the following command: ALTER DATABASE …

WebNov 16, 2024 · Check the Compatibility Level. To do it in the SSMS GUI, right click the database in the Object Explorer: Click Properties from the context menu. This opens the … WebNov 16, 2015 · Open DBList.txt and replace server and database names as required. Alternatively, execute the PowerShell script passing the name of the server and the database as parameters and skip the third step. For example: ./HealthCheck.ps1 Server1\InstanceA DB1. Execute HealthCheck.bat. The report can be found in the \HealthCheck\Reports …

WebJul 2, 2013 · We are on SQL2008R2 but a few of the legacy and 3rd party databases are in mode = 80. Having now tested on our development server there are issues when incrementing the compatibility mode, so we are taking the appropriate steps with the vendors and developers. SELECT name, compatibility_level from sys.databases reveals …

WebMay 22, 2015 · select 'Alter database '+Name +' SET COMPATIBILITY_LEVEL ='+ cast( (select Compatibility_level from sys.databases where name='master') as varchar(3)) from sys.databases where Compatibility_level not in (select Compatibility_level from sys.databases where name='master') or christopher mcclure ctWebNov 21, 2013 · -- Management view (files) SELECT db_name (database_id) as database_nm, * FROM sys.dm_db_file_space_usage GO The only way to rebuild the table so that it is on one file is to create a new file group and a … get tomorrow\u0027s date power automateWebJul 14, 2024 · In order to see the compatibility level of the databases, right-click on the database in Microsoft SQL Server Management Studio and select Properties, then click the Options tab. Go to root-database > right … get tomorrow\\u0027s date python